Hi, folks.  I was going to take another crack at the performance
optimizations in HtRegexList, but before that, I got down to tackling
some of the config parser bugs that had been nagging at us for quite
some time.  Please have a look at this patch, and test it as much as
possible, to see if it causes any problems.  The fixes in there are:

- improved error handling, gives file name and correct line number, even
  if using include files
- allows space before comment, because otherwise it would just complain
  about the "#" character and go on to parse the text after it as a
  definition
- allows config file with an unterminated line at end of file, by pushing
  an extra newline token to the parser at EOF
- parser correctly handles extra newline tokens, by moving this handling
  out of simple_expression, and into simple_expression_list and block, as
  simple_expression must return a new ConfigDefaults object and a newline
  token doesn't cut it (caused segfaults when dealing with fix above)

Apply using "patch -p0 < this-message-file".

--- htcommon/conf_lexer.lxx.orig	2003-12-14 07:40:12.000000000 -0600
+++ htcommon/conf_lexer.lxx	2004-04-22 15:47:48.000000000 -0500
@@ -41,6 +41,7 @@
 #define MAX_INCLUDE_DEPTH 10
 YY_BUFFER_STATE include_stack[MAX_INCLUDE_DEPTH];
 String *name_stack[MAX_INCLUDE_DEPTH];
+int lineno_stack[MAX_INCLUDE_DEPTH];
 int include_stack_ptr = 0;
 %}
 
@@ -50,7 +51,7 @@ STRING			[\x21-\xff]+
 BR_STRING		[^ \n\t<>]+
 %%
 
-^#.*\n			/*   Ignore comments     */
+^[[:space:]]*#.*\n	/*   Ignore comments     */
 ^[[:space:]]*\n		/*   Ignore emty lines   */
 <*>[ \t]+		/*   Ignore spaces       */
 include[ \t]*:		BEGIN(incl);
@@ -157,6 +158,8 @@ include[ \t]*:		BEGIN(incl);
 			}
 			name_stack[include_stack_ptr-1] =
 					new String(ParsedFilename.get());
+			lineno_stack[include_stack_ptr-1] = yylineno;
+			yylineno = 1;
 		        yy_switch_to_buffer( yy_create_buffer( yyin, YY_BUF_SIZE ) );
 
 		        BEGIN(INITIAL);
@@ -164,10 +167,18 @@ include[ \t]*:		BEGIN(incl);
 
 <<EOF>> 		{
 		        if ( include_stack_ptr <= 0 )
+			    {
+			    static int termnext = 0;
+			    // fix to allow unterminated final line
+			    if (++termnext <= 1)
+				return(T_NEWLINE);
+			    termnext = 0;	// in case we're called again
 		            yyterminate();
+			    }
 		        else
 		            {
 			    delete name_stack[include_stack_ptr-1];
+			    yylineno = lineno_stack[include_stack_ptr-1];
 		            yy_delete_buffer( YY_CURRENT_BUFFER );
 		            yy_switch_to_buffer(
 		                 include_stack[--include_stack_ptr] );
@@ -183,7 +194,13 @@ include[ \t]*:		BEGIN(incl);
 
 \n			
 <*>.|\n		{ 
-	fprintf(stderr,"Unknown char in line %d: %s",yylineno,yytext);
-	// exit(1); // Seems to harsh!
+	HtConfiguration* config= HtConfiguration::config();
+	String str;
+	if (include_stack_ptr > 0)
+	    str = *name_stack[include_stack_ptr-1];
+	else	// still at top level config
+	    str = config->getFileName();
+	fprintf(stderr,"Unknown char in file %s line %d: %s\n",str.get(),yylineno,yytext);
+	// exit(1); // Seems too harsh!
 	}
 %%
--- htcommon/conf_parser.yxx.orig	2003-11-22 07:40:17.000000000 -0600
+++ htcommon/conf_parser.yxx	2004-04-22 15:48:54.000000000 -0500
@@ -84,6 +84,7 @@ block:        simple_expression		{   
           //    ... : ...
           // </server>
 	}
+        | T_NEWLINE	{ /* Ignore empty lines */  }
 ;
 
 simple_expression:      T_KEYWORD T_DELIMITER T_STRING T_NEWLINE	{ 
@@ -116,7 +117,6 @@ simple_expression:      T_KEYWORD T_DELI
 				    $$->value=new char[1];
 				    *$$->value='\0';
 					}
-        | T_NEWLINE	{ /* Ignore empty lines */  }
 ;
 
 complex_expression:	T_LEFT_BR T_KEYWORD T_DELIMITER T_STRING T_RIGHT_BR T_NEWLINE simple_expression_list T_LEFT_BR T_SLASH T_KEYWORD T_RIGHT_BR T_NEWLINE {
@@ -170,6 +170,7 @@ simple_expression_list:   simple_express
 				delete $2;
 				//$$=$1; //I think $$==$1
 			}
+			| T_NEWLINE	{ /* Ignore empty lines */  }
                       ;
 
 list:	  T_STRING T_STRING			{ 
@@ -253,8 +254,17 @@ list:	  T_STRING T_STRING			{ 
 int
 yyerror (char *s)  /* Called by yyparse on error */
 {
-extern int yylineno;	// I don't know what about included files
-   fprintf (stderr, "%s\nIn line %d\n",s,yylineno);
+extern int yylineno;
+extern int include_stack_ptr;
+extern String *name_stack[];
+   HtConfiguration* config= HtConfiguration::config();
+   String str;
+   if (include_stack_ptr > 0)
+	str = *name_stack[include_stack_ptr-1];
+   else	// still at top level config
+	str = config->getFileName();
+   //fprintf (stderr, "%s\nIn line %d\n",s,yylineno);
+   fprintf(stderr,"Error in file %s line %d: %s\n",str.get(),yylineno,s);
    // exit(1);
    return -1;
 }
